Ten Tips to Sell Your Home Faster

A large house is sitting on top of a lush green field.

Selling your home? It’s a thrilling adventure, but let’s be real—it can also be a bit nerve-wracking. Whether you’re upgrading, downsizing, or heading off to a new city, you want that “SOLD” sign up ASAP, right? The good news is, there are some tried-and-true tricks to get your home off the market in no time—and maybe even get a little extra cash in the process. Let’s dive into some fun, practical tips to speed up your sale!


1. Price It Like a Pro

Setting the right price is like matchmaking—too high, and buyers swipe left; too low, and you’re leaving money on the table. Find that sweet spot by working with a savvy real estate agent. They’ll help you with a comparative market analysis (fancy talk for “what are other homes like yours selling for?”) to make sure your price is just right.


2. Give Your Home Some Curbside Love

First impressions aren’t just for job interviews—they’re for houses, too! Make your home irresistible from the moment buyers pull up. Mow the lawn, trim those hedges, maybe even throw a fresh coat of paint on the front door. Adding a few cute potted plants or flowers can also work wonders. It’s like dressing your home for a first date!


3. Declutter Like a Pro Organizer

Let’s face it—your stuff is great, but buyers want to picture their stuff in the house. Time to declutter! Put away those personal photos, keep counters clean, and stash away anything that makes your home feel too “you.” Less clutter also magically makes your space look bigger. Win-win!


4. Fix Those Little Quirks

Got a leaky faucet or a door that doesn’t quite shut? Time to tackle those little repairs. Buyers tend to worry that small issues might lead to bigger ones later, so a quick fix-up will put their minds at ease and make your home more appealing.


5. Stage to Wow

Home staging is like setting up your home’s Instagram page—everything should look fabulous and ready for its close-up. Rearrange furniture to highlight the best features, make the space feel inviting, and consider hiring a professional stager if you want to go the extra mile. You wouldn’t believe how much faster a staged home can sell!


6. Market Like a Boss

The more eyes on your home, the faster it’ll sell. Make sure your listing is everywhere—from real estate sites to social media. An experienced real estate agent will also have some killer marketing strategies and a network to get your home seen by the right buyers. Maximum exposure = maximum offers!


7. Picture-Perfect Photography

Let’s be real—most buyers start their search online, and if your photos aren’t top-notch, you’re missing out. Invest in professional photography to showcase your home’s best angles. Good lighting, wide-angle shots, and crisp, clear images can make your listing pop!


8. Say Yes to More Showings

The more people who see your home, the more likely you’ll find that perfect buyer. Be flexible with your showing schedule—weekends, evenings, whenever! The easier it is to tour your home, the faster it’s likely to sell.



9. Get a Real Estate Agent on Your Team

A great real estate agent is your secret weapon. They know the market, can give you expert advice, handle the marketing, and negotiate on your behalf. Find an agent who’s a rock star in your area, and you’ll be closing in no time.


10. Sweeten the Deal

Want to make buyers fall in love with your home even faster? Offer a few perks! Maybe you cover part of the closing costs, throw in a home warranty, or offer a decorating allowance. A little incentive can push hesitant buyers to say, “Let’s do this!”


Wrap-Up

Selling your home doesn’t have to be stressful. With the right price, a little sprucing up, and some smart marketing, you’ll be hearing offers in no time. Each home and market are unique, so feel free to tailor these tips to your specific situation. Now go get that SOLD sign ready—you’ve got this!
